Debt Servicing Gulps N6.16trillion in 16 months

Debt service gulped N6.16tn in 16 months. This is according to the 2023-2025 Medium Term Expenditure Framework & Fiscal Strategy Paper. It revealed that in 2021, the Federal Government spent N4.22trillion on debt service, and N1.94trillion between January and April 2022.

Justin and Hailey Bieber’s Home Violated by Trespasser

Police arrested a trespasser at Justin and Hailey Bieber's home last weekend. Reports say the Security Team spotted a guy who broke into the backyard in an exclusive gated Los Angeles community. He was spotted hanging out by the couple's BBQ, and took off running when the security approached him. Justin and Hailey were not home as they were away on vacation.

Chelsea to Appoint Freund as Sporting Director

Reports say Chelsea football club is close to appointing Christian Freund as their new Sporting Director. According to reports, Freund is set to quit Red Bull Salzburg for Stamford Bridge. Chelsea have also been linked with a move for Paris Saint-Germain advisor Luis Campos and reportedly offered him £135,000-a-week.
